    Abstract

    This package includes the reproducible data construction pipeline for Women, Business and the Law 2026, which will be used in the Women, Business and the Law 2026 report. The output datasets consist of cleaned Women, Business and the Law (WBL) 2026 economy-level scores. These outputs will be published and made publicly available at: https://wbl.worldbank.org/en/wbl-data

    Reproduction instructions

    The underlying raw data used in this project are restricted and subject to special approval processes. As a result, most users will not be able to access the raw inputs or fully reproduce the data construction from scratch. For transparency and methodological documentation, this reproducibility package therefore includes the full analysis and data-processing code, but does not include the restricted raw datasets.

    Users who have been granted access to the underlying restricted data can reproduce the results by:

    • Placing the approved raw datasets in the folder structure described in this repository.
    • Opening the main script (master.do).
    • Updating the local paths if needed.
    • Running the script from start to finish.

    Source: World Bank Filenames: ENT_ENF_FAM_LAB_COMBINED_RESP_Level_EPValid.dta, FAMILY_RESP_Level_EPValid.dta, FAMILY_Wrk_GetaJob_ForLabor_RESP_Level_EPValid.dta, LABOR_RESP_Level_EPValid.dta, VAW_RESP_Level_EPValid.dta, WBL26_DMS_LF_Cleaned_Raw_Data.dta, WBL26_DMS_SF_Cleaned_Raw_Data.dta The WBL team utilizes a custom-built Data Management System (DMS) to review respondents' answers to survey questions and record verified values. Raw data refers to the original input datasets downloaded from the DMS following a multi-level review process to ensure accuracy for analysis, and cleaned by dropping variables irrelevant for the scoring process. The final WBL index and scores for the WBL 2026 Report are calculated using these raw datasets. DMS was designed to ensure data confidentiality: The system is accessible online only when connected to the World Bank’s network and requires a username and password to sign in. Access is only granted to the WBL team members. Parties interested in accessing these datasets must contact the Women, Business and the Law team to request access to the following email address: wbl@worldbank.org
